The itinerary winds its way through the hills of the Aso valley, passing through some of the world’s most famous medieval towns and UNESCO heritage sites. These are just some of them.
1 - TORRE DI PALME
Very close to the coast, its views are breathtaking. It dates back as far as the 11th century…

2 - lapedona
A grand total of seven churches for fewer than 1200 residents, a small historic town contained within the walls of an ancient castle…
4 - MORESCO
Moresco Castle is part of the Borghi Più Belli d’Italia (Italy’s Prettiest Towns) association. It is located on the peak of a hill overlooking the Aso valley beneath it. From here the views over Mts. Conero and Gran Sasso are spectacular…

5 - MONTERUBBIANO
Touring Club Italiano Bandiera Arancione (orange flag) winner, it is one of the Fermo hinterland’s gems. Packed with works of art and ancient traditions to be discovered, it dominates the Aso valley…
6 - PETRITOLI
Its origins date back to the year 1000. A long history has led to a wealth of art and architecture gems as well as magnificent romantic views which have earned it the name of “wedding town”, as it attracts couples from all over the world.
